Transaction 8805e66662a8bae0ef03899e73636b81466f343a0d7f7f9e1c765648a805bb14
1 Input
1 Output
-
8805e66662a8bae0ef03899e73636b81466f343a0d7f7f9e1c765648a805bb14:0
- value
- 311535
- script pubkey
- OP_0 OP_PUSHBYTES_20 643c58aa9b24ed5bef715ede354e6a316d4a3a87
- address
- bc1qvs79325mynk4hmm3tm0r2nn2x9k55w58c288uq